The state of Nevada has a wide variety of terrain to explore. It's not just desert! It includes high mountains, dunes, desert, forests, and washes. There are many trails to explore that are very close to Nevada's main attractions too - namely Carson City and Las Vegas.
Because most of Nevada is desert, please use caution and common sense when out and about. The desert's heat and distance from civilization can be a deadly combination. Please bring more water than you think you'll need, extra food, and a CB/GMRS radio. If you do get stuck alone, you may be subject to 120 degree days and sub zero nights depending on when you are and what season it is.
